Gymnasium environment for the game Kuzonga
Project description
KuzongaEnv
A custom Gymnasium-compatible environment for the Kuzonga game.
Environment Details
Action Space
The environment uses a dictionary action space with three components:
| Key | Value | Description |
|---|---|---|
| v | 1 or 0 (or True and False, respectively) | Whether to attempt division (1) or change a digit (0). |
| g | 0–9 | If v=1, the divisor; if v=0, the new digit to set at r. |
| r | 0…digits-1 or None |
Rindex (Right-to-left or reverse index) of the digit to overwrite (if v=1, it should be None). |
Example:
action = {"v": 1, "g": 3, "r": None} # attempt division by 3
action = {"v": 0, "g": 7, "r": 1} # set the second digit (from the right) to 7
Observation Space
The environment uses a dictionary observation space with the following keys:
| Key | Type | Description |
|---|---|---|
| s | np.int8 array (digits,) | The original number as an array of digits. |
| d | np.int8 array (digits,) | The current number as an array of digits. |
| a | np.int64 array (digits*10,) | Binary mask of which digits can be set at each position. Flattened from shape (digits, 10). |
| p | np.int64 array (num_players*3,) | Each player’s [i, c, m], where i is the ID, c is the score and m tells if it is the player's turn (m=1) or not (m=0). Flattened array of all players. It has one player by default. |
| t | int | ID of the player whose turn it is. |
Example:
obs, info = env.reset()
print(obs["s"]) # [1, 7]
print(obs["d"]) # [4, 7]
print(obs["a"]) # array([1,1,0,...])
print(obs["p"]) # array([0,0,1,1,0,0]) # two players
print(obs["t"]) # 0
Quick Notes
The a mask ensures illegal moves (e.g., setting a leading zero or creating number 0/1) are prevented.
Rewards and penalties are automatically updated in the environment during step().
The environment fully supports multiple players, and tracks turns via t and m.
The options parameter in reset() allows resetting the environment to a specific given state/obs, by setting it with the format: options = {'obs': <state/obs dict>}
The fifth returned value of the method step (commonly the info variable) has the field obs_decoded which has the plain values of the resulting state/observation. So it can be retrieved as info['obs_decoded']
Usage Example
import gymnasium as gym
import kuzongaenv
env = gym.make("Kuzonga-v0")
obs, info = env.reset()
action = env.action_space.sample()
obs, reward, terminated, truncated, info = env.step(action)
print(f"Observation: {obs}")
print(f"Reward: {reward}, Terminated: {terminated}")
Installation
pip install -e .
